The best PWA implementation I used is from Gnome Web (supports running in background for notifications).
But performance & compatibility of Gnome Web is meh.

Firefox doesn't support this.

So I guess that some Chromium derivative is the best compromise (can't remember if running PWA in background is supported)

I didn't try Linux Mint's derivative of PWA manager.

For Figma, https://github.com/Figma-Linux/figma-linux would be better as that supports local fonts. Or at least the font helper from the same org, but for that to work the browser has to have a windows/chrome user agent.
